Deep Loot logo Deep Loot

Deep Loot is a side scrolling roguelike that is free to play but includes in app purchases that range from $0.99 - $6.99 per item.

Tallowmere logo Tallowmere

2D action roguelike-inspired platformer with procedurally generated rooms for a new experience...
